Totowa, NJ: Rowman and Littlefield, Date: 1980. Scholarly attempt to clarify Peirce's thought; the author asserts that previous scholars' differing account are inconsistent. Part of the APQ (American Philosophical Quarterly) Library of Philosophy series. The author was a professor of philosophy at Georgia State, and president of the Charles S. Peirce Society.
